Without World Cup winner: Dortmund must do without star player

She was the big winner at the Women's World Cup in Batumi – after a tiebreaker, Divya Deshmukh won the final against Humpy Koneru this week, crowning the greatest triumph of her young career.

Divya Deshmuk AnkündigungShe herself did not expect to make it all the way to the final and had actually planned to travel to the Sparkassen Chess Trophy 2025 to participate in the A Open. Unfortunately, due to some official appointments in her home country of India, she will not be able to make it to Dortmund in time and has to withdraw her participation.

The organisers of Initiative Pro Schach e.V. fully understand and congratulate her on winning the title! An invitation to the 2026 International Dortmund Chess Days will follow, and Deshmukh has already promised to try to make room for the tournament in her schedule next year.
